Airport Runway Repair in Little Rock, AR
Airport runway repair services focus on maintaining and restoring the smooth surface of runways used at airports and private airstrips. These projects typically involve fixing cracks, potholes, and surface wear caused by weather, frequent aircraft landings, and general aging. Property owners with private airstrips or small airports often request these repairs to ensure safety, proper drainage, and optimal aircraft performance. Before requesting runway repair services, property owners should understand the extent of surface damage, the materials used in the existing runway, and any specific requirements for aircraft operations to ensure the repairs meet safety standards.
These services cover a range of projects including patching damaged areas, resurfacing entire runways, and addressing drainage issues that can impact the longevity of the surface. It’s important for property owners to evaluate the current condition of their runway and consider factors like the size of the area needing repair, the frequency of aircraft use, and local weather conditions. Clear communication about the runway’s condition and usage needs can help determine the most appropriate repair approach and ensure the runway remains safe and functional for its intended purpose.

Common Airport Runway Repair Jobs
Asphalt Repair - restoring damaged or cracked runway surfaces for safe aircraft operations.
Surface Resurfacing - applying new layers to improve smoothness and extend runway lifespan.
Pothole Filling - sealing potholes to prevent further deterioration and ensure operational safety.
Concrete Patching - repairing cracks and holes in concrete runways for structural integrity.
Drainage Improvement - installing or repairing drainage systems to prevent water accumulation.
Line Painting - refreshing runway markings for clear navigation and compliance.
Airport Runway Repair Questions
What causes runway damage that requires repairs? Common causes include weather exposure, heavy aircraft traffic, and aging materials that lead to cracks and surface deterioration.
How are runway repairs typically performed? Repairs involve removing damaged sections, cleaning the area, and applying new asphalt or concrete to restore surface integrity.
Are runway repairs necessary for safety? Yes, maintaining a smooth and sturdy surface is essential to ensure safe aircraft operations and prevent accidents.
What should property owners know before scheduling repairs? Proper assessment of the existing surface helps determine the appropriate repair method and ensures long-lasting results.
